Good take out sushi. Either select among the pre-made sushi or place an order.The rotating $6 daily special is a great value.Wish the ehomaki was served all year bc the fillings are unique & delicious.Friendly service.Weekday parking is fairly easy in the small shared parking lot.TIP: They have a stamp card.

SPICY AHI AVOCADO @hawaii_sushi 3045 Monsarrat Ave Suite 1, Honolulu, HI*@hawaii_sushi is a Japanese owned sushi small business that is new (to me). This was my first time stumbling upon them after going on a run on my most recent trip home. The staff is super kind, the store is clean, and there are lots of pictures to help you decide on what you want to order. They have poke, sushi, and specialty bowls.*I ordered the Spicy Ahi Avocado Bowl and it was probably one of the best bites I had back home this time around. The spicy ahi is smashed into this creamy texture that is complemented by even more creaminess from the avocado. We demolished it in 5 minutes because the creamy texture and taste was so satisfying. *10/10 would go back again. Next time I definitely want to try their poke like the ginger ahi . #chopsticksnboots
